Luke 12:1-12 (새번역): Here, we can see how Jesus speaks to His disciples and the large crowd and gives them warnings and encouragements: 1. Be[a] on your guard against the yeast of the Pharisees, which is hypocrisy; There is nothing concealed that will not be disclosed, or hidden that will not be made known. 2. Fear him who, after your body has been killed, has authority to throw you into hell. Yes, I tell you, fear him; 3. He warns them that anyone who blasphemes against the Holy Spirit will not be forgiven and that the Holy Spirit will teach them at that time what they should say when brought before synagogues, rulers and authorities.
